Default Idling problems...?

Hey guys, sometimes when my 02 GT, 5 speed idles (around 650-750), it starts to make a ticking noise that remains until i rev it a few times. A friend of mine said it was just the hydraulic lifters and it was perfectly normal, but i never noticed it until after i installed a MAC CAI and my BBK o/r X Pipe. Also, after idling for a while when its warm, it will start to whine a bit, with nothing except the brakes held. Usually when i rev it up a bit, it goes away, but the other day, it got worse as i revved it, then finally went away. Any ideas to what these two problems might be, and if they're really major or not? Thanks guys.

first chck your oil level, but mine does the same thing and it is the lifters tapping (normal when starting up) this happens because it takes a second for the oil to reach the lifters, but it should go away after a min or so
